Which of the following functional groups is present in carboxylic acids?
  • Step 1: Understand what a functional group is. A functional group is a specific group of atoms within a molecule that is responsible for the characteristic chemical reactions of that molecule.
  • Step 2: Learn about carboxylic acids. Carboxylic acids are a type of organic compound that contains a specific functional group.
  • Step 3: Identify the functional group in carboxylic acids. The functional group in carboxylic acids is called the carboxyl group.
  • Step 4: Recognize the structure of the carboxyl group. The carboxyl group is represented as -COOH, which consists of a carbon atom double-bonded to an oxygen atom and also bonded to a hydroxyl group (-OH).
  • Step 5: Conclude that carboxylic acids are defined by the presence of the carboxyl functional group (-COOH).
